Crawlspace waterproofing services focus on protecting the area beneath a building from excess moisture, water intrusion, and related issues. These services typically involve installing waterproof barriers, drainage systems, and vapor barriers to prevent water from seeping into the crawlspace. Proper waterproofing helps maintain a dry environment, which can be essential for preserving the structural integrity of the foundation and preventing mold growth. Contractors may also include sealing cracks, improving drainage around the property, and installing sump pumps to manage water accumulation effectively.

Addressing moisture problems in crawlspaces is crucial for preventing a range of issues that can affect the entire property. Excess moisture can lead to wood rot, mold growth, and pest infestations, all of which compromise the safety and durability of a home or commercial building. Additionally, damp environments in crawlspaces can contribute to higher energy costs, as moisture and poor insulation reduce overall energy efficiency. Waterproofing services aim to mitigate these risks by creating a barrier against water infiltration and controlling humidity levels.

The overview below groups typical Crawlspace Waterpro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Pierce County,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Cost Range - The typical cost for crawlspace waterproofing services can vary from $1,500 to $5,000 depending on the size and condition of the area. Larger or more complex projects tend to be on the higher end of the spectrum.

Factors Affecting Price - Factors such as the extent of moisture issues, type of waterproofing system, and accessibility influence costs. For example, installing a vapor barrier might cost around $1,500, while comprehensive sealing could reach $4,500 or more.

Average Expenses - On average, homeowners in Pierce County can expect to spend between $2,000 and $4,000 for professional waterproofing services. Costs may increase if additional repairs or drainage systems are required.

Cost Variability - Prices for crawlspace waterproofing services vary based on local contractor rates and project complexity. It is advisable to cont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is crawlspace waterproofing? Crawlspace waterproofing involves sealing and protecting the area beneath a building to prevent water intrusion, mold, and moisture issues.

Why is waterproofing a crawlspace important? Proper waterproofing helps maintain a dry environment, reduces mold growth, and protects the structural integrity of the building.

What methods do local service providers use for crawlspace waterproofing? Contractors may use techniques such as vapor barriers, sump pumps, drainage systems, and sealing walls to keep the crawlspace dry.

How can I tell if my crawlspace needs waterproofing? Signs include persistent dampness, mold growth, a musty odor, or visible water during heavy rains or flooding.
